Upgrade Your Professionalism

Whether you’re digging ditches or building rockets to space, there’s always room to upgrade your professionalism.

When you do, you’ll gain more respect, wield more influence among your peers, and earn more opportunities to increase your productivity and success.

The road to increased professionalism in your chosen field of endeavor is neither short nor easy, but you’ll certainly find the journey itself rewarding. In addition, you’ll discover that upgrading your professionalism leads to exciting opportunities and enviable destinations you cannot reach by any other route.

Here are some of the most important ways you can upgrade your professionalism:

Acquire More Expert Information

As a professional, you’re called upon to do more than most others, and this generally requires knowing, understanding, and making use of more complex information. You can start to upgrade your professionalism by solidifying and expanding your knowledge base.

What’s more, the information you as a professional are able to bring to bear on any given task or situation is continually eroding and falling out of date as your field of activity advances. For this reason, it’s important to steadily explore the cutting edge to learn what’s new. At the same time, you’ll want to regularly review and revitalize the baseline information you learned in the past.

Expand Your Mastery

Part of your professionalism is based on your skills – both the range of skills you can apply to a given situation and your proficiency with those skills. The broader your range of skills and the more proficiently you can utilize them, the more robust your professionalism.

Tools often constitute another aspect of your professionalism. Whether they include a shovel for digging ditches or an understanding of the maximum dynamic pressure a rocket must withstand during launch, as a professional you want to routinely use your tools as effectively as possible. This requires competence and confidence, of course. It also requires repeated practice with both the tools and with the intense concentration required to use them well.

As an interesting side-note, recognize that the better you can use your tools, the more reason you have to take pride in your professionalism.

Seek Out Responsibility

One reason professionals are held in high regard is they routinely take responsibility and deliver expected results. You can enhance your professionalism by looking for additional opportunities in your work and your life to do both of these.

One way is to keep your eyes and ears open for challenging opportunities, as well as for situations that are giving other people difficulties. By contributing – or at least offering – your efforts to such situations, you will normally enhance your reputation as a professional.

Of course, contributing or offering your efforts constitutes a commitment which you must honor. Once you dive in, you cannot dive back out. So be prepared to stick with your responsibilities to the end, always doing your best and helping others to do their best, as well.

Maintain Equilibrium Under Pressure

Professionals are appreciated not only because they deliver expected results, but because they routinely do so under conditions that would derail the efforts of less-qualified people. This requires an ability to perform at a high level when the pressure is “on,” when you’re not at the top of your game, and when unforeseen difficulties arise.

Delivering professional results under unfavorable conditions takes practice, which is another reason for seeking out responsibility. The more responsibility you take, and the more often you take it, the more experience you’ll gain at operating professionally when others would likely wilt.

Because professionals are highly respected and valued, they are more readily considered for exciting and rewarding opportunities. The more professionalism you develop, the more productive and successful you are likely to become.
